Unwavering Patriotism in Times of Crisis
Kuzmenko was more than a musician; he was a patriot who believed in the power of music to inspire and unite. When Ukraine faced the tumult of 2014, with the conflict in Donbas and the annexation of Crimea, he was among the first to recognize the gravity of the situation. Understanding it as more than just an anti-terrorist operation, Kuzmenko offered unwavering support to those on the front lines, volunteering his time and resources.
The Unfinished Symphony
Tragically, Andriy Kuzmenko's life was cut short on February 2, 2015, when he died in a car accident near the village of Lozuvatka. While returning from a concert in Kryvyi Rih, his vehicle collided with a milk truck, leading to fatal injuries.
